After separating from his wife, Leonard Parker (Cosby) quit the spy business and became a restaurateur. His wife refuses to speak with him, and his daughter, who changes her career more often than her clothes, has begun dating a man old enough to be Leonard's father! On top of it all, the government has asked him to come back and save the world again. The evil Medusa Johnson (Foster) has hypnotized animals into doing her bidding, and plans to use them to take over the world! It's up to Leonard to save the world, as only he can battle her Vegetarians and man-eating rabbits! The CIA asks for ex-spy Leonard's help in stopping an evil force that is brainwashing small animals into killing people. Leonard, however, has his own problems to deal with: winning back his ex-wife.
